Abstract

  Optimizing the Indonesian Smart College Card (KIPK) Program in Citizenship Education has a strategic role in forming a young generation who is superior, intelligent and has character. Citizenship education contributes to the formation of moral values, strengthening anti-corruption education, national integration, introducing national identity and understanding the rights and obligations as citizens. This article aims to highlight the importance of synergy between the KIPK program and citizenship education in everyday life in order to produce a highly competitive generation. The research method used in this writing uses a literature review by analyzing various literature from journals, books, theses and other relevant sources. The results of the study show that if the KIPK program is optimized through citizenship education, it will have a significant positive impact on the quality of the younger generation both in terms of intellectual and civic character. It is believed that this implementation can support the grand vision of Golden Indonesia 2045 by creating superior human resources with good character.
